Serotonin maleate acts as a selective agonist for 5-HT receptors in the central nervous system, influencing various physiological processes, including mood regulation and cognitive function. Additionally, it serves as a catechol O-methyltransferase (COMT) inhibitor with a Ki value of 44 μM, making it valuable for research involving neurotransmitter dynamics and the modulation of serotonergic pathways. Its multiple biological activities position it as a critical reagent for studies in neuroscience and pharmacology.
